This error means that pm_ApiCli::callSbin is supported in Linux only because on Windows there are no sbin utilities.
This error means that pm_ApiCli::call can be called only from scripts. It's not supported when you make some actions in UI. It's because of security...
And more over: now upgrade from Plesk 10 to Plesk 12 is supported. Maybe future releases won't support such in place upgrade and you'll need to use migration for such case.

1. Run the following command to remove blocking you rows: plesk db "DELETE FROM apsResources WHERE pleskId IN (SELECT id FROM domains WHERE name = 'maresvirtuales.com')"
2. Run the following command to fix other inconsistencies: plesk repair db -y
3. Try to remove subscription again: plesk bin...
Compare output of the following commands:
# plesk sbin ifmng --list
# ifconfig -a | grep "inet addr"
# ip addr list | grep "inet "
Do they return the same IP addresses except 127.0.0.1?

In Plesk there is other way to change docroot in the UI:
1. go to domain overview page
2. click Hosting Settings
3. specify correct Document root
